Dark Green

The color #314029 is a dark green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 49, 64, 41 and HSL values of 99°, 22%, 21%.

Complementary Colors for #314029

The complementary color for #314029 is #392A41.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#314029

The analogous colors for #314029 are #3E412A and #2A412D.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#314029

The triadic colors for #314029 are #2A3241 and #412A32.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
